Backpack: 2.0 lbs
Start with the Hyperlite Mountain Gear SOUTHWEST 55 Backpack. This lightweight and durable backpack is made from Dyneema Composite Fabric. Switching to this pack was a game changer. *Note: if you are a hot sweaty mess, it can get a bit hot in the back.

Sleep System (Bag, Pad, Shelter): 2.0 lb

Outdoor Research Helium Bivy - not everyone is into Bivy bags, but for 8oz,  I love them. So great for solo camping. Keep the bugs out, without needing a full blown tent or a trekking pole.

Sea to Summit Spark Ultralight Down Sleeping Bag It's 850 fill, 40 degree temperature range and weighs just 12 ounces.

Therm-a-Rest NeoAir Xlite NXT superlight, and a great fit in the bivy for 13oz.

4. Cooking Gear: 26 oz
Choose the BRS Outdoor Ultralight Camping Stove, a compact and efficient canister stove. Seriously small and light at .9 oz . Packs a punch

Pair it with the ROCREEK Titanium 750ml Pot with Lid, a lightweight cooking vessel that doubles as a cup. 25 oz
